117.info
人生若只如初见

ubuntu环境下如何安装驱动程序

在Ubuntu环境下安装驱动程序通常涉及以下步骤:

使用软件包管理器安装驱动程序

  1. 更新系统包信息
sudo apt update
  1. 搜索并安装驱动程序
sudo apt search package-name
sudo apt install package-name

package-name替换为您要安装的驱动程序包的名称。

手动安装驱动程序

  1. 下载驱动程序
  • 从硬件制造商的官方网站下载所需的驱动程序。
  • 常见的文件格式有.deb(适用于Debian/Ubuntu系统)和.run(适用于NVIDIA显卡驱动)。
  1. 安装依赖
sudo apt-get install build-essential
  1. 解压缩并编译安装
  • 如果下载的是.tar.gz文件:
tar -zxvf driver.tar.gz
cd driver-directory
sudo make
sudo make install
  • 如果下载的是.deb文件:
sudo dpkg -i package-name.deb
  1. 重启系统
sudo reboot

使用Ubuntu自带的“附加驱动程序”工具

  1. 打开“软件和更新”界面
  • 点击“附加驱动程序”选项。
  1. 选择所需的驱动程序并安装
  • 选择标记有recommended(建议安装)的驱动进行安装。

通过PPA仓库安装驱动程序

  1. 添加PPA仓库
sudo add-apt-repository ppa:graphics-drivers/ppa
sudo apt update
  1. 安装推荐的驱动程序
sudo apt install nvidia-driver-xxx

xxx替换为推荐的驱动版本。

安装NVIDIA显卡驱动的具体步骤

  1. 查看显卡型号
lspci | grep -i nvidia
  1. 禁用nouveau驱动
sudo vim /etc/modprobe.d/blacklist-nouveau.conf

添加内容:

blacklist nouveau
options nouveau modeset=0

更新initramfs并重启:

sudo update-initramfs -u
sudo reboot
  1. 使用软件更新器或命令行安装驱动
  • 使用软件更新器:
sudo ubuntu-drivers autoinstall
  • 使用命令行:
sudo ./NVIDIA-Linux-x86_64-xxx.run

常见问题及解决方法

  • 安装过程中出现黑屏:确保在安装NVIDIA显卡驱动时,选择不覆盖xorg配置文件,或者在安装前关闭所有GUI界面。
  • 驱动安装后无法识别硬件:重启系统后,使用nvidia-smi或相应硬件的检测工具检查驱动是否安装成功。

通过以上步骤,您应该能够在Ubuntu系统中成功安装所需的驱动程序。如果在安装过程中遇到问题,请参考硬件制造商的官方文档或在社区论坛上寻求帮助。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fee88AzsKAgVeBVc.html

推荐文章

  • Ubuntu dmesg日志中的硬盘读写错误怎么解决

    当Ubuntu的dmesg日志中出现硬盘读写错误时,可以尝试以下几种方法来解决问题:
    检查和修复文件系统
    使用fsck命令检查和修复文件系统中的错误。首先,重...

  • Ubuntu dmesg日志显示USB设备连接问题怎么办

    当Ubuntu的dmesg日志显示USB设备连接问题时,可以按照以下步骤进行排查和解决:
    查看dmesg日志
    首先,使用以下命令查看dmesg日志中与USB相关的信息:<...

  • Ubuntu dmesg日志中的内核错误怎么处理

    当Ubuntu系统中的dmesg日志出现内核错误时,可以采取以下步骤进行处理:
    查看内核错误日志 使用 dmesg命令查看内核日志。这将显示系统启动以来的内核环缓冲...

  • Ubuntu dmesg日志显示文件系统错误怎么办

    当Ubuntu的dmesg日志显示文件系统错误时,可以按照以下步骤进行排查和修复:
    1. 查看详细的错误信息
    首先,使用 dmesg 命令查看具体的错误信息。例如:...

  • Linux服务器Java环境如何搭建

    在Linux服务器上搭建Java环境通常包括以下几个步骤:
    1. 下载JDK
    首先,你需要从Oracle官方网站下载适用于Linux系统的JDK安装包。你可以选择适合你的L...

  • Java程序在Linux上运行慢怎么办

    Java程序在Linux上运行慢可能是由于多种原因造成的,以下是一些常见的原因和相应的解决方法:
    1. 检查系统资源 CPU:使用 top 或 htop 命令检查CPU使用情况...

  • Linux环境下Java如何高效部署

    在Linux环境下高效部署Java应用可以通过以下几种方法实现:
    1. 使用包管理器安装Java
    对于基于Debian的系统(如Ubuntu),可以使用以下命令安装OpenJD...

  • Java在Linux上的最佳实践是什么

    在Linux上使用Java时,遵循一些最佳实践可以帮助您提高应用程序的性能、安全性和可维护性。以下是一些关键的最佳实践:
    系统选择 基础镜像:选择适合您需求...